Purchasing Power Analysis
A Instructional Coordinators in Redmond, WA earns $50,918 in nominal terms, which is 2.1% below the national average of $52,000. After adjusting for the local cost of living (index 114.6 vs national 100), this is equivalent to $44,431 in national-average purchasing power.
Tax differences are not included. Only cost-of-living index adjustments are applied.
